The drawer's surface_validate area now leads with a row of operator
vitals computed from data already in the response:
- Temp: drive temperature with cool/warm/hot colour (≥48 red, ≥42 yellow)
- Speed: live MB/s, NULL until second progress sample arrives
- Elapsed: time since stage started_at
- ETA: extrapolated from overall progress; suppressed under 0.5%
to avoid the "47 days remaining" artefact early in pattern 1
Live MB/s comes from a new bb_mbps column on burnin_stages, computed
in the badblocks parser as (delta_overall_pct / 800) * size_bytes / dt.
Skipped on phase transitions (per-phase pct resets) and sub-second
samples (noisy).
Drawer endpoint now passes drive.temperature_c through; JS stashes
the latest drive object in _DRAWER_LAST_DRIVE so the burn-in renderer
can pull it for the vitals row without changing call signatures.
